⊟Summary[edit | edit source]
- organism: Streptococcus pneumoniae A66
- locus tag: A66_01708 [new locus tag: A66_RS08575 ]
- pan locus tag?: PNEUPAN003434000
- symbol: A66_01708
- pan gene symbol?: rumA-2
- synonym: rlmD
- product: RNA methyltransferase, TrmA family
